  • Patent number: 11828052
    Abstract: A toilet seal for sealing between a plumbing fixture discharge and a waste drainpipe outlet is described. The toilet seal comprises a flange member having an inwardly extending flexible lip. A flexible sleeve extends downwardly from the flange member. The toilet seal further includes a compressible member having an upper surface disposed adjacent to a lower surface of the flange member. The compressible member further has a lower surface and a plurality of ridges extend downwardly from the lower surface of the compressible member.

  • Patent number: 10689680
    Abstract: Methods for making a synthetic nucleic acid which comprise: (a) identifying a conflicting nucleotide sequence in a target sequence; (b) inserting a masking sequence into the conflicting sequence to produce a disrupted target sequence, wherein: (i) the masking sequence comprises recognition sites for one or more Type IIS restriction endonucleases; and (ii) digestion of said disrupted target sequence by said one or more Type IIS restriction endonucleases followed by re-ligation reconstitutes the target sequence; (c) synthesizing a polynucleotide comprising the disrupted target sequence using polymerase chain assembly; and (d) removing the masking sequence from said polynucleotide by digesting said polynucleotide with said one or more Type IIS restriction endonucleases followed by re-ligation of the digestion product, thereby producing a polynucleotide comprising said target sequence.
